LL60 LYS is a 2010 Toyota Prius in White with a 1,797cc hybrid electric (clean) eng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 86.7%.
Across all 2010 Toyota Prius models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.6% with a typical mileage of 109,942 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Toyota Prius f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 14,116 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LL60 LYS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Prius typ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 16 years old, this Toyota Prius is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
